Transaction 5b61e5ab0753dd0dda260a30ac42b4bc0cedbda0b1ee21bf755f565a30584ffc
1 Input
1 Output
-
5b61e5ab0753dd0dda260a30ac42b4bc0cedbda0b1ee21bf755f565a30584ffc:0
- value
- 303583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 335c0d6febad9179b3ac7376835b35e413d2c778 OP_EQUAL
- address
- 36NafFENUtmJEA1bq7piDWroncZDGX3yex